Early experience with titanium elastic nails in a trauma unit.

M H Shah1, G Heffernan, A J McGuinness

  • 1Cork University Hospital, Wilton, Cork, Ireland.

Irish Medical Journal
|October 2, 2003
PubMed
Summary

The Titanium Elastic Nail (TEN) provides effective treatment for pediatric long bone fractures, significantly reducing hospital stays. While generally successful, minor complications like insertion pain and superficial infections were noted.

Area of Science:

  • Orthopedic surgery
  • Pediatric orthopedics
  • Biomaterials

Background:

  • Traditional treatments for pediatric long bone fractures often involve prolonged immobilization and hospitalization.
  • The Titanium Elastic Nail (TEN) presents a minimally invasive alternative with potential benefits for pediatric fracture management.

Purpose of the Study:

  • To evaluate the early clinical experience and outcomes of using Titanium Elastic Nails (TEN) for treating long bone fractures in children.
  • To assess the efficacy and safety of TEN fixation in a pediatric cohort.

Main Methods:

  • A retrospective review of 13 pediatric patients treated with TEN for various long bone fractures over two years.
  • Clinical and radiological assessments were performed to evaluate fracture union, alignment, and complications.

Main Results:

  • All 13 fractures achieved union, with significant reductions in hospital stay, particularly for femoral fractures (5-8 days).
  • Minor complications included one case of delayed union requiring bone grafting, one instance of positional loss, insertion site pain in 4 patients, and two superficial wound infections.
  • No deep infections, limb length discrepancies, or rotational/angular malalignments were observed.

Conclusions:

  • Titanium Elastic Nails (TEN) demonstrate a favorable outcome for pediatric long bone fractures, offering advantages in reduced hospital stay and early mobilization.
  • While generally safe and effective, careful patient selection and monitoring are important to manage potential complications such as delayed union and insertion site issues.
